Common Signs And Symptoms of Vision Problems in Children
When you discover your kid struggling with day-to-day activities, maybe a sign of vision problems.
Search for signs like scrunching up your eyes, massaging their eyes often, or turning their head to see far better. If they've problem analysis or seem to shed their area often, that's another indicator.
You could also see them complaining regarding headaches or experiencing eye strain after extensive durations of analysis or making use of screens.
Additionally, if your child stays clear of activities that call for great vision, like sports or drawing, it's worth paying attention to.
Watch for any type of uncommon behavior, as these indicators can indicate underlying vision concerns that need expert examination.
Early detection can make a large distinction in their aesthetic advancement.
Age-Specific Vision Milestones to Screen
Every moms and dad needs to keep an eye on their child's vision growth as they grow.
At around 6 months, your baby needs to begin tracking relocating items. By age 1, they should be able to concentrate on and acknowledge acquainted faces.
In between 2 and 3 years, search for enhancements in hand-eye control, like stacking blocks or tossing a ball.
By age 4, kids must have the ability to recognize forms and colors, and they may start to acknowledge letters.
If your child deals with these turning points, it's necessary to keep in mind. Checking their progression assists you capture prospective concerns early, guaranteeing they receive the vision care they require for a bright future.

When to Arrange an Eye Test for Your Kid
Monitoring your kid's vision advancement is important, however knowing when to schedule an eye test is equally as important. The American Academy of Ophthalmology recommends your kid have their first eye exam at 6 months old.
After that, routine follow-ups at age 3 and again before they start institution. If your child reveals signs of vision concerns-- like scrunching up your eyes, trouble analysis, or headaches-- do not wait for the following arranged consultation.
Furthermore, if there's see more of eye problems, proactive exams are crucial. Watch on any kind of adjustments in their vision or habits, and trust fund your reactions.
Routine check-ups can assist catch potential concerns early, ensuring your youngster has the most effective possibility for healthy eyesight.
